How to Install and Uninstall stm32flash Package on Ubuntu 21.10 (Impish Indri)

Last updated: May 18,2024

1. Install "stm32flash" package

Please follow the guidance below to install stm32flash on Ubuntu 21.10 (Impish Indri)

$ sudo apt update $ sudo apt install stm32flash

2. Uninstall "stm32flash" package

Here is a brief guide to show you how to uninstall stm32flash on Ubuntu 21.10 (Impish Indri):

$ sudo apt remove stm32flash $ sudo apt autoclean && sudo apt autoremove

Description-en: STM32 chip flashing utility using a serial bootloader
stm32flash is a flashing program for the STM32 ARM processors using the ST
serial bootloader compliant with application note AN3155.
.
Features:
* device identification
* write to flash/RAM
* read from flash/RAM
* auto-detect Intel hex or raw binary input format with option to force binary
* flash from binary file
* save flash to binary file
* verify and retry up to N times on failed writes
* start execution at specified address
* software reset the device when finished if -g not specified
* resume already initialized connection (for when reset fails)
* GPIO signalling
* I²C support
